The area around Windermere is often considered one of the most beautiful parts of the Lake District, especially at the north end around Ambleside.Windermere and the surrounding area is arguably the most famous and popular area in the Lake District.Keswick became widely known for its association with the poets Samuel Taylor Coleridge and Robert Southey. Together with their fellow Lake Poet William Wordsworth, based at Grasmere, 12 miles (19 kilometres) away, they made the scenic beauty of the area widely known to readers in Britain and beyond.Grasmere – Where Nature and Poetry Unite For those with a literary bent, Grasmere is a must-visit Lake District location. William Wordsworth lived in this picturesque village, and considered it not only the most beautiful place in the Lake District, but indeed, ‘the loveliest spot that man hath ever found’.
